1 definition by ZanL.Jackson

Top Definition
Someone who is a notorious moocher, first used in The Simpsons episode "Milhouse Doesn't Live Here Anymore".
"Hey man, let me go buy another round. You guys have any money? My shout next time, I promise"

"Dude, that's what he says everytime. He keeps mooching off of us. He's a Moocholini"
by ZanL.Jackson July 14, 2009
Mug icon
Buy a Moocholini mug!